Standard molecular sieves rely on clay binders (typically 15-20% by weight) to form stable spheres or extrudates, which dilutes the active zeolite content. Our technical roadmap highlights the development of binderless molecular sieves. By converting inert binders into active crystalline frameworks, we increase dynamic adsorption capacity by up to 25%, drastically reducing vessel footprint.
Targeting the mitigation of greenhouse gases, our research team is optimizing advanced Carbon Molecular Sieves (CMS) and modified 13X zeolites. These materials are engineered with precise pore structures capable of distinguishing between nitrogen and carbon dioxide under low-pressure swing adsorption (VPSA) conditions, accelerating cost-effective decarbonization.
For applications such as deep natural gas purification and ultra-high purity hydrogen production, we are introducing transition-metal ion exchanges (e.g., silver and copper-exchanged matrices). This allows the selective chemisorption of organosulfur compounds, siloxanes, and trace phosphines down to parts-per-billion (ppb) levels.

Water and acid gas removal is vital before cryogenic liquification (LNG) to prevent pipe freezing and corrosion. Our molecular sieves offer low attrition rates, minimizing dust formation and protecting downstream compressor components. They deliver reliable dew points of below -100°C (-148°F).
To produce high-purity nitrogen, oxygen, and argon cryogenically, moisture and CO2 must be completely removed. We provide optimized prepurifier adsorption beds combining activated alumina (for bulk moisture removal) with specialized 13X molecular sieves (for CO2 and trace gas removal), reducing regeneration energy consumption.
Fuel-grade ethanol requires dehydration to 99.5% purity or higher. The distillation process is limited by the water-ethanol azeotrope. JOOZEO 3A molecular sieves selectively exclude ethanol molecules while capturing water, allowing continuous operation in vapor-phase pressure swing adsorption (PSA) systems.

The difference lies in the nominal pore diameter of the crystal lattice. 3A (3 Angstroms) is ideal for dehydrating unsaturated hydrocarbons and ethanol without co-adsorbing organic compounds. 4A (4 Angstroms) selectively adsorbs water, carbon dioxide, and hydrogen sulfide. 5A (5 Angstroms) acts as a divalent calcium-exchanged structure that can co-adsorb normal alkanes while excluding branched isomer structures. 13X (Type X crystal framework, 10 Angstroms) has the largest pore diameter, making it suitable for co-adsorption of larger nitrogenated and oxygenated compounds, as well as general prepurification of air separation streams.
Adsorption is an exothermic process. As the temperature of the gas or liquid stream increases, the physical forces binding water molecules to the zeolite cage weaken, shifting the thermodynamic equilibrium and reducing dynamic water capacity. For applications operating at elevated process temperatures, special cooling or pre-refrigeration units are recommended to maintain low dew point performance.
Thermal regeneration (TSA) requires heating the bed to between 200°C and 320°C. A dry slip stream of purge gas (such as nitrogen or dry methane) is passed through the bed to carry away desorbed water vapor and hydrocarbons. After heating, the bed must be cooled back to the operating temperature using a dry purge stream before switching back to adsorption mode.
Attrition is caused by mechanical friction between beads, high fluid velocities (fluidization), or thermal shock during fast heat-up cycles. Our manufacturing process controls crush strength, ensuring our zeolites withstand high gas flows and cyclic thermal pressure changes without crumbling.
Standard zeolites (A-type and X-type) have low silicon-to-aluminum ratios, making them susceptible to structural breakdown in acidic environments. For streams containing high concentrations of sour gas (H2S, CO2), we recommend high-silica zeolites or acid-resistant activated alumina to prevent crystalline degradation.
